and that the President and the Supreme Court were on their side and that the next war would be a greater one than the last, and requested me to report him, etc. I simply told him that I feared the government would not consider him of any importance. Martial law, being removed this is a cheap kind of braggadocio that is becoming prevalent. There has been a great change here, since the passage of the military bill, and I feel more like a man in Virginia than I have in twelve months. The power of the government begins to be respected. I am, General, Very respectfully Your Ob't Serv't J.A. Yeckley Lt. & Asst. Supt Bureau R.F. & A.L.
